What does Washington Salmon Recovery Funding Board spend the most on?
Based on 35 tracked contracts, Washington Salmon Recovery Funding Board spends most on Grants (23), Information Technology (5), Environmental Services (3), Legal & Compliance (2), and Public Works (2). Contract types include CONSTRUCTION, MAINTENANCE, and PROFESSIONAL_SERVICES. Who are Washington Salmon Recovery Funding Board's current vendors?
Washington Salmon Recovery Funding Board currently works with vendors including MID-COLUMBIA FISHERIES ENHANCEMENT GROUP, SKAGIT RIVER SYSTEM COOPERATIVE, KING COUNTY WATER & LAND RESOURCES, CHELAN COUNTY, SOUTH PUGET SOUND SALMON ENHANCEMENT GROUP, NOOKSACK INDIAN TRIBE, SKAGIT COUNTY, SAN JUAN COUNTY DEPARTMENT OF ENVIRONMENTAL STEWARDSHIP, WILD FISH CONSERVANCY, and METHOW SALMON RECOVERY FOUNDATION. These vendors span contract types like CONSTRUCTION, MAINTENANCE, and PROFESSIONAL_SERVICES.
